The most common reasons a 2024 BMW M3 won't start are a dead battery, an alternator problem, or failed starter.
  • Battery: A weak or failing battery can result in difficulty starting the engine and electrical system malfunctions.
  • Alternator: A failing alternator can result in insufficient electrical power, leading to battery drain and electrical system malfunctions.
  • Starter: A faulty starter motor or a weak battery can prevent the engine from cranking properly, leading to starting issues.

What steps should I take to diagnose the starting issue in my 2024 BMW M3?

When diagnosing a starting issue in your 2024 BMW M3, it's essential to adopt a systematic approach that begins with the simplest solutions before progressing to more complex diagnostics. Start by checking the battery, as a weak or dead battery is often the most common culprit behind starting problems. If the battery is in good condition, move on to inspect the starter motor, which is crucial for turning the engine over. Next, examine the ignition switch to ensure it functions properly; a faulty switch can prevent the engine from starting altogether. After that, evaluate the fuel system to confirm that fuel is reaching the engine, as issues with the fuel pump or injectors can hinder starting. Don’t forget to check the spark plugs for wear, as faulty plugs can also lead to starting difficulties. If these components appear to be in good shape, use a diagnostic tool to scan for error codes, which can provide insights into any underlying issues. Finally, inspect the alternator, as a malfunctioning alternator can result in insufficient power to start the vehicle. By following this structured diagnostic approach, you can effectively identify and address the starting issue in your BMW M3.

What are the common problems that could cause a 2024 BMW M3 to not start?

When troubleshooting a 2024 BMW M3 that won't start, it's essential to consider several common problems that could be at play. One of the first areas to check is the battery, as a dead or weak battery is often the culprit behind starting issues. Ensure that the battery connections are clean and secure, and consider testing the battery's voltage. Next, examine the fuel system; a clogged fuel filter or a malfunctioning fuel pump can impede fuel delivery, preventing the engine from starting. Additionally, the ignition system plays a critical role in starting the vehicle, so inspect the spark plugs and ignition coils for any signs of wear or failure. If the starter motor is not engaging, it may indicate a problem with the starter itself or its wiring. Furthermore, the Engine Control Module (ECM) can also be a source of trouble, particularly if there are sensor malfunctions or software issues. Lastly, don't overlook the vehicle's security system, as a faulty immobilizer or key fob can inadvertently prevent the engine from starting. By systematically checking these components, DIYers can effectively diagnose and resolve starting issues with their BMW M3.
